com.mojang.math

public record GivensParameters

e
com.mojang.math.GivensParameters
net.minecraft.class_8218
net.minecraft.util.math.GivensPair
net.minecraft.src.C_276130_
com.mojang.math.GivensParameters

Field summary

Modifier and TypeField
private final float
a
sinHalf
comp_1317
sinHalf
f_276143_
private final float
b
cosHalf
comp_1318
cosHalf
f_276137_

Constructor summary

ModifierConstructor
public (float f_276137_, float arg1)

Method summary

Modifier and TypeMethod
public static GivensParameters
a(float arg0, float arg1)
fromUnnormalized(float arg0, float arg1)
method_49727(float arg0, float arg1)
normalize(float a, float b)
m_276229_(float p_276277_, float p_276305_)
public static GivensParameters
a(float arg0)
fromPositiveAngle(float arg0)
method_49726(float arg0)
fromAngle(float radians)
m_276195_(float p_276260_)
public GivensParameters
a()
inverse()
method_49725()
negateSin()
m_276224_()
public org.joml.Quaternionf
a(org.joml.Quaternionf arg0)
aroundX(org.joml.Quaternionf arg0)
method_49729(org.joml.Quaternionf arg0)
method_49729(org.joml.Quaternionf arg0)
m_276196_(org.joml.Quaternionf arg0)
public org.joml.Quaternionf
b(org.joml.Quaternionf arg0)
aroundY(org.joml.Quaternionf arg0)
method_49732(org.joml.Quaternionf arg0)
method_49732(org.joml.Quaternionf arg0)
m_276212_(org.joml.Quaternionf arg0)
public org.joml.Quaternionf
c(org.joml.Quaternionf arg0)
aroundZ(org.joml.Quaternionf arg0)
method_49735(org.joml.Quaternionf arg0)
method_49735(org.joml.Quaternionf arg0)
m_276202_(org.joml.Quaternionf arg0)
public float
b()
cos()
method_49730()
cosDouble()
m_276191_()
public float
c()
sin()
method_49733()
sinDouble()
m_276211_()
public org.joml.Matrix3f
a(org.joml.Matrix3f arg0)
aroundX(org.joml.Matrix3f arg0)
method_49728(org.joml.Matrix3f arg0)
method_49728(org.joml.Matrix3f arg0)
m_276201_(org.joml.Matrix3f arg0)
public org.joml.Matrix3f
b(org.joml.Matrix3f arg0)
aroundY(org.joml.Matrix3f arg0)
method_49731(org.joml.Matrix3f arg0)
method_49731(org.joml.Matrix3f arg0)
m_276214_(org.joml.Matrix3f arg0)
public org.joml.Matrix3f
c(org.joml.Matrix3f arg0)
aroundZ(org.joml.Matrix3f arg0)
method_49734(org.joml.Matrix3f arg0)
method_49734(org.joml.Matrix3f arg0)
m_276210_(org.joml.Matrix3f arg0)
public float
d()
sinHalf()
comp_1317()
sinHalf()
f_276143_()
public float
e()
cosHalf()
comp_1318()
cosHalf()
f_276137_()